Pithos Public Trash Can by Nikolaos Baskozos
Pithos Public Trash Can
This litter bin design subtly refers to the form of an ancient Greek jar. The design approach is abstract and simple. Fiber reinforced concrete and stainless steel are the two materials used for the construction of this object. To replace the bin bag, at first, one has to open the stainless steel lid. A shutter of the waste hole prevents rainwater from entering the bin.

ahaDRONE Kit Cardboard Drone by Srinivasulu Reddy
ahaDRONE Kit Cardboard Drone
ahaDRONE, a lightweight drone designed to fit within the 18 inch square corrugated board, a paperboard engineered for aerospace applications. The flatpack do-it-yourself kit includes all components necessary to build a cardboard drone along with a detachable safety guard. The assembled drone has an all up weight of 250 grams and airframe weighing 69 grams. The flight controller includes accelerometer, gyroscope, magnetometer and barometer, can be ⥅

Pep Rocking Stool by Omar Qubain and Tina Saghbini
Pep Rocking Stool
Pep is a timeless piece of furniture that satisfies the innate playfulness desire of human beings. It is a simple stool composed of three nesting parts that can rock or sway, either separately or as one collective. Pep is composed of only four materials; beech plywood, pastel coloured felt and full grain leather held by brass clip. It is portable, elegant and most importantly fun!

Abacus Bookshelves And Coat Hanger by Wai Ho Cheung
Abacus Bookshelves And Coat Hanger
Abacus is a multi-functional wall-mount bookshelves and coat hanger inspired by the Chinese abacus and steelyard balance. Abacus consists of wood blocks with clean edges and flying double-wire rails. The lighter-shape hooks can move along the wires. The hooks can conceal behind the blocks, which can be also used as bookends and coat hangers. Users can also hang objects in between the rails. Abacus is extendable by installing additional sets. ⥅
